The $3,000 Nine Game Mixed final table is live at the Horseshoe right now, and if you have any stake in the 25kFantasy contest, Joey Couden's 30-point ceiling for team Browndog is the single most consequential sweat still in play this morning.

Couden started the final table four-handed. As of about 5:38 a.m. PT, he's down to heads-up — 53 points already locked for Andrew Brown's Browndog roster, with a ceiling of 83 if he takes it down.

Couden has 53 points locked for Browndog with a ceiling of 83 — a 30-point swing that could reshape the 25kFantasy leaderboard.

Why This Stream Matters

Nine Game Mixed doesn't usually draw casual viewers. Eight rotations of games most people can't spell, played at a pace that makes limit hold'em look like a slot machine. But the fantasy overlay changes the calculus entirely.

That 30-point delta between Couden's floor and ceiling is enormous. In a salary-cap contest where rosters are separated by single digits, locking the full 83 versus settling at 53 could be the difference between cashing and watching someone else cash. If you're on Browndog — or competing against Browndog — you need to be watching.

What You're Looking At

Couden is heads-up in Event #52. The mixed-game rotation means momentum swings hard between streets and between games. One bad Razz round, one scooped Stud Hi-Lo pot, and the match flips. These aren't coin-flip situations — they're grinding, positional battles where small edges compound across rotations.

The stream is running now on PokerGO. Mixed-game heads-up matches at the WSOP tend to run one to three hours depending on stacks, so expect a resolution sometime before 9 a.m. PT.
